Output 34600eb79fec43fcf2238012366fb594be583c58788e210e8f736bcd8ea00269:11

value
181860631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31cd8ceb6fc938aae809aae60b7c25229d615d4 OP_EQUAL
address
MQEDk5w98ruVwDTU1pS4vf8fK5tDzd8yns
transaction
34600eb79fec43fcf2238012366fb594be583c58788e210e8f736bcd8ea00269
spent
true